With stunning views of Port Douglas in the south and the beautiful and historical Low Isles Lighthouse, Newell offers tourists a divine beach that extends throughout the entire locale. Due to its stunning location, the area of Newell is mostly full during the summer, while surfers flock to the area to catch some huge waves during the off-peak season. There are a number of estuaries in the northern and southern part of the beaches, making it an interesting destination for tourists and families.
If tired of the beach life, families may choose to visit the World Heritage-listed site found in Daintree National Park. The nearby national park has some of the most endangered species of flora and fauna in the country. Visitors may choose to explore the outdoors or hang out in the shaded areas found within the park.
